Abstract
A series of arylmercuric dithizonate complexes have been synthesized and characterized. Optical spectra of dissolved and pure compounds show transition energies around 480 nm which have been rationalized by semiempiric PM3 calculations. All complexes show a pronounced photochromism. The calculations also account for the observed blue absorption of the metastable species when an underlying geometric arrangement according to the proposal of Meriwether's is assumed.
